引言 在加密货币的世界中,钱包地址是进行交易的关键组成部分。对于USDT(泰达币)这种重要的稳定币,找到正确的...
以太坊(Ethereum)是一种去中心化的平台,允许开发者在其上构建和部署智能合约和去中心化应用(DApp)。随着以太坊的普及,越来越多的人开始关注如何安全地存储和管理他们的数字资产,这就不可避免地引入了以太坊钱包的概念。在本文中,我们将深入探讨以太坊钱包的创建原理、机制以及安全性,帮助读者更好地理解如何创建和管理自己的以太坊钱包。
以太坊钱包是一个存储以太坊(ETH)及其相关代币的工具。与传统钱包不同,数字钱包不存储实际的货币,而是保留了用于访问区块链上资产的私钥和公钥。公钥是可以公开分享的,用于生成以太坊地址,而私钥则是保密的,能够用来签名交易,从而证明你对该地址上资产的控制。
以太坊钱包可以分为热钱包和冷钱包两种类型。热钱包通常在线连接,方便用户随时访问,但相对来说安全性较低。冷钱包则是离线的,例如硬件钱包,提供更高的安全性,但在使用时需要在线连接。
以太坊钱包的创建过程可以分为几个关键阶段,包括生成密钥对、生成地址以及钱包的初始化。下面将逐一阐述这些过程。
每个以太坊钱包都由一对密钥组成:公钥和私钥。密钥对的生成通常依赖于某种加密算法,如椭圆曲线加密(ECDSA)。通过随机数生成器产生随机序列,结合椭圆曲线算法生成一对密钥。公钥通过数学算法从私钥生成,而私钥则是保密的。保持私钥的安全是确保以太坊钱包安全性的关键。
生成以太坊地址的过程是从公钥到地址的映射过程。首先,公钥经过SHA-256和Keccak-256哈希算法进行处理,以生成一个散列值。随后,从这个散列值中取出最后的40个字符(20个字节),并且添加前缀“0x”以示区分。此时,一个新的以太坊地址就被生成了。
一旦密钥对及地址生成完成,钱包的初始化就完成了。用户可以通过特定的界面来管理他们的以太坊资产。这通常涉及到账户余额查看、交易发送与接收等功能。用户需要将产生的私钥安全存储,而公钥和地址则可以安全地共享给其他用户进行交易。
以太坊钱包的安全性是用户十分关注的话题,特别是在数字货币交易增多的背景下,安全漏洞的风险也随之上升。如何保护钱包的安全,防止黑客攻击和资产被盗,是每个用户需要了解的核心知识。
私钥是钱包的“钥匙”,一旦被黑客获取,就意味着钱包中的资产处于风险之中。因此,存储私钥的方式尤为重要。用户应选择离线存储的方式,如纸钱包或硬件钱包,避免将私钥保存在连接互联网的设备上。保持私钥的复杂性和足够的随机性也是提高安全性的必要措施。
为了进一步提升钱包的安全性,用户可以采取多重签名(Multisig)钱包的方式。这种钱包要求多位用户共同签署交易,确保任何单一用户无法单独访问资产。这种方式在提升安全性的同时,也在一定程度上增加了操作的复杂性,适合对安全性有高要求的用户。
选择合适的钱包类型也对安全性有重要影响。冷钱包,如硬件钱包,是安全性较高的选项,通常用于存储大量数字资产。热钱包则适合频繁交易的用户,因为其操作更加便利。但用户在使用热钱包时,必须保持警惕,定期更新安全软件,确保网络安全。
私钥存储的安全性是保护资产的关键。建议用户采取以下几种方式存储私钥:
总之,无论采用何种方式,需牢记私钥不要与他人分享,避免通过不安全的渠道传输,确保其安全的第一步是确保生成和存储环境的安全。
丢失以太坊钱包或私钥的情况可能发生,但对于有备份的用户,恢复相对简单。以下是恢复步骤:
请注意,恢复钱包资产的过程可能因不同的钱包软件而异。如果切记没有备份私钥或助记词,恢复的可能性则非常低,因此建议用户定期备份和更新资料,确保其资产安全性。
选择合适的以太坊钱包需要考虑多个因素,包括安全性、用户体验和功能等。以下是选择钱包时可能影响决策的几个要素:
在作出最终选择之前,可以对比不同钱包的优缺点,阅读其他用户的评价,并评估其是否适合自己的需求。始终谨慎而周全地对待选择钱包投资的过程。
以太坊交易手续费主要由运营网络的矿工收取,目的是激励他们处理和验证交易。手续费的计算受多种因素影响,包括:
初次使用以太坊钱包的用户应时刻关注实时的手续费动态,合理评估自己交易的急迫性与所支付的手续费,以做出合理的手续费选择,确保交易的顺利进行。
以太坊钱包的创建原理、机制及安全性是理解数字货币交易的基础。在创建和管理以太坊钱包的过程中,用户需要重视密钥的安全性,选择合适的钱包类型,并提升个人的安全意识。通过有效的资产管理,用户将能够安全地参与到以太坊生态系统中。